Alumni
The University of Tasmania Library offers their alumni members Library borrower membership free of charge.
Alumni are entitled to access limited electronic resources, you don't need to register, or be located in Tasmania to access these resources. Please note: if you do not have access to your UTAS email username and password, you will need to contact with the Alumni Office. Once your email account has been reactivated, you will automatically have access to these resources.
To Borrow (Tasmanian residents only):
Complete the online application form
- When you are registering we will set you up with a Library PIN so that you can request and manage your loans
To renew your membership:
If your Alumni library borrowing card has expired and you would still like to borrower items from our collections, please email us. You must include the following
- Borrower card number
- Full name
- Address and phone number
How many books can I borrow?
No. of items | Loan period | Renewals |
---|---|---|
25 | 28 days | 3 |
Alumni Borrowers can:
- Request items and borrow from any UTAS Library (Tasmanian based Alumni only)
- Request a scan of a chapter, extract or article from a print item
- Access some electronic resources when off campus and a wider range of resources when visiting the Library in person
- Access the library during staffed opening hours
- Access free and open Guest Wifi on campus, no credentials required. Sign in to UGuest wireless network and follow the on-screen instructions. Note: a mobile phone will be required to receive your login details.

Royal Hobart Hospital
The University of Tasmania Library offers Staff of the Royal Hobart Hospital Library Borrower membership.
To Join
Complete the online application form, ensuring that you:
- Provide supporting documentation with your application - Photo ID & evidence of current address and proof of current employment with RHH
- When you are registering we will set you up with a Library PIN so that you can request and manage your loans
How many books can I borrow?
Low Demand Items (General Collection)
No. of items | Loan period | Renewals |
---|---|---|
25 | 28 days | 3 |
High Demand Items
Item Category | Number of Items | Number of Renewals |
---|---|---|
Reserve - 2 hr | 2 | 1 |
Reserve - 24 hr | 2 | 1 |
Royal Hobart Hospital Staff Borrowers can:
- Request items and borrow from any UTAS Library
- Request a scan of a chapter, extract or article from a print item
- Access some electronic resources when visiting the Library in person
- Get help from UTAS Library staff
- Access the library during staffed opening hours
- Access free and open Guest Wifi on campus, no credentials required. Sign in to UGuest wireless network and follow the on-screen instructions. Note: a mobile phone will be required to receive your login details.

Students & Staff of other Universities
University of Tasmania Library borrower membership is available to current staff and students (based in Tasmania) from universities who participate in the following reciprocal borrowing program. This membership is free and eligibility criteria apply.
List of participating universities
Students of Universities not participating in ULANZ are welcome to join as a member of the General Public .
Open University students enrolled at other universities may join as a member of the general public.
Members within Tasmania of - University of the Third Age (U3A) are welcome to join as a member of the General Public.
To Join
Complete the online application form, ensuring that you:
- Provide supporting documentation with your application : Photo ID, proof of enrolment or membership to another university & evidence of current Tasmanian address
- When you are registering we will set you up with a Library PIN so that you can request and manage your loans
How many books can I borrow?
No. of items | Loan period | Renewals |
---|---|---|
25 | 28 days | 3 |
Borrowers can:
- Request items and borrow from any UTAS Library
- Request a scan of a chapter, extract or article from a print item
- Access some electronic resources when visiting the Library in person
- Access wireless on your devices using eduroam
- Access the library during staffed opening hours
